Default Braid for trout in streams

Since I fish almost everyday presently for trout , can’t help but notice a lot more braid in some streams. One day last week I pulled up a piece about 50’ long and others 1/2 that length .
Not sure what the logic is using braid for trout , leaving it in streams is dangerous for animals and fishermen etc . So for unknown reason you fish braid for trout that’s fine but if you break off please get it out of the stream if possible !
That goes for mono as well , it’s easy to roll up and put in vest pocket to dispose of later keeps everyone safe .

Problem with braid is it won't break. Many don't use leaders but tie direct, most just cut the line on braid.
True
If they had a dowel or thick stick they can wrap it around a dozen times and pull Just like bottom fishing in the ocean.
More times than just losing your lure you bend the hooks and don’t leave all that line in the water making an environmental hazard.
